Book a Demo!
CoCalc Logo Icon
StoreFeaturesDocsShareSupportNewsAboutPoliciesSign UpSign In
PojavLauncherTeam
GitHub Repository: PojavLauncherTeam/mesa
Path: blob/21.2-virgl/src/intel/tools/tests/gen6/mov.asm
4549 views
1
mov(8) g7<1>F g4<8,8,1>D { align1 1Q };
2
mov(8) m1<1>F g7<8,8,1>F { align1 1Q };
3
mov(16) g7<1>F g5<8,8,1>D { align1 1H };
4
mov(16) m1<1>F g7<8,8,1>F { align1 1H };
5
mov(8) m2<1>D 0D { align16 1Q };
6
mov(8) m3<1>F 0x41880000F /* 17F */ { align16 1Q };
7
mov(8) m1<1>UD g0<4>UD { align16 WE_all 1Q };
8
mov.sat(8) m4<1>F g4<4>F { align16 1Q };
9
mov(8) m2<1>.wF g5<4>.xF { align16 1Q };
10
mov(4) m2<1>F g2.3<8,2,4>F { align1 WE_all 1N };
11
mov(8) m2<1>D g3.3<0,1,0>D { align1 1Q };
12
mov(8) m5<1>UD g4.7<0,1,0>D { align1 1Q };
13
mov(8) g10<1>F g2<0,1,0>F { align1 1Q };
14
mov(8) m2<1>F 0x0F /* 0F */ { align1 1Q };
15
mov(16) m2<1>D g3.3<0,1,0>D { align1 1H };
16
mov(16) m8<1>UD g4.7<0,1,0>D { align1 1H };
17
mov(16) g17<1>F g2<0,1,0>F { align1 1H };
18
mov(16) m3<1>F 0x0F /* 0F */ { align1 1H };
19
mov(8) m5<1>UD 0D { align1 1Q };
20
mov(8) g2<1>F g6<8,4,1>UW { align1 1Q };
21
mov(8) g7<1>D g2<8,8,1>F { align1 1Q };
22
mov(8) m2<1>D g11<8,8,1>F { align1 1Q };
23
mov(16) m8<1>UD 0D { align1 1H };
24
mov(16) g2<1>F g4<8,8,1>UW { align1 1H };
25
mov(16) g8<1>D g2<8,8,1>F { align1 1H };
26
mov(16) m2<1>D g16<8,8,1>F { align1 1H };
27
mov(8) m1<1>F -g38<8,8,1>D { align1 1Q };
28
mov(16) m1<1>F -g6<8,8,1>D { align1 1H };
29
mov(1) m22<1>D 0D { align1 WE_all 1N };
30
mov(8) m23<1>D g3<0>D { align16 1Q };
31
mov(8) g28<1>.xD 1D { align16 1Q };
32
mov(1) m22<1>D g39<0,1,0>D { align1 WE_all 1N };
33
mov(8) m4<1>.xD 1059749626D { align16 NoDDClr 1Q };
34
mov(8) m4<1>.yD 1143373824D { align16 NoDDClr,NoDDChk 1Q };
35
mov(8) m5<1>.yD -1093874483D { align16 NoDDChk 1Q };
36
mov(8) m5<1>.xzF 0x7e0020VF /* [0.5F, 0F, 30F, 0F]VF */ { align16 NoDDChk 1Q };
37
mov(8) m1<1>F g0<8,8,1>F { align1 WE_all 1Q };
38
mov(1) m1.2<1>UD 0x000003f2UD { align1 WE_all 1N };
39
mov(8) m2<1>F g16<8,8,1>F { align1 2Q };
40
mov(8) g5<1>F 0x30003000VF /* [0F, 1F, 0F, 1F]VF */ { align16 1Q };
41
mov(8) m4<1>F 0x30003000VF /* [0F, 1F, 0F, 1F]VF */ { align16 1Q };
42
mov(8) g21<1>F g11<8,8,1>F { align1 2Q };
43
mov(1) g0.2<1>UD 0x00000000UD { align1 WE_all 1N };
44
mov(8) g6<1>.xUD 0x00000000UD { align16 1Q };
45
mov(8) g20<1>.xD 0x00000000UD { align16 1Q };
46
mov(8) g21<1>UD 0x00000000UD { align16 WE_all 1Q };
47
mov(8) m2<1>.xyzD g3.4<0>.xyzzD { align16 NoDDClr 1Q };
48
mov(8) g22<1>.xD g6<4>.xUD { align16 1Q };
49
mov(8) g27<1>UD 7D { align16 1Q };
50
mov(1) m1.1<1>UD g9<0,1,0>UD { align1 WE_all 1N };
51
mov(8) m2<1>F g30<4>F { align16 WE_all 1Q };
52
mov(8) g13<1>D 0D { align1 1Q };
53
mov(16) g9<1>D 0D { align1 1H };
54
mov.sat(8) m1<1>F g2<0,1,0>F { align1 1Q };
55
mov.sat(16) m1<1>F g2<0,1,0>F { align1 1H };
56
mov(8) g16<1>UD g1.4<0>UD { align16 1Q };
57
mov(8) m4<1>.wD g9<4>.wD { align16 NoDDChk 1Q };
58
mov(8) g19<1>.xD g18<4>.xF { align16 1Q };
59
mov(8) m4<1>F g[a0]<VxH,1,0>F { align1 1Q switch };
60
mov(8) m8<1>F g[a0]<VxH,1,0>F { align1 2Q switch };
61
mov(8) m2<1>UD 0x00000000UD { align1 1Q };
62
mov(16) m2<1>UD 0x00000000UD { align1 1H };
63
mov(8) m3<1>F g14<4>.xD { align16 1Q };
64
mov.sat(8) m4<1>.xF 0x3f800000F /* 1F */ { align16 NoDDClr 1Q };
65
mov.sat(8) m4<1>.yF 0x3f666666F /* 0.9F */ { align16 NoDDClr,NoDDChk 1Q };
66
mov.sat(8) m4<1>.wF 0x3f333333F /* 0.7F */ { align16 NoDDChk 1Q };
67
mov(1) g32<1>F 0x40000000F /* 2F */ { align1 WE_all 1N };
68
mov(8) m17<1>UD g0<8,8,1>UD { align1 WE_all 1Q };
69
mov(8) g12<1>F g11<4>D { align16 1Q };
70
mov(8) g30<1>.xyD g3.4<0>.xyyyD { align16 NoDDClr 1Q };
71
mov(8) g30<1>.wD 0D { align16 NoDDChk 1Q };
72
mov(4) g28<1>F g23.1<4,4,1>F { align1 WE_all 1N };
73
mov(8) g26<1>UD 0x403000VF /* [0F, 1F, 2F, 0F]VF */ { align16 WE_all 1Q };
74
mov(4) m2<1>UD g101<4>UD { align16 1N };
75
mov(8) g19<1>.yzwD 0x48403000VF /* [0F, 1F, 2F, 3F]VF */ { align16 1Q };
76
mov(8) g11<1>UD g11<4>F { align16 1Q };
77
mov(8) g12<1>F g11<4>UD { align16 1Q };
78
mov(8) m1<1>UD g3<8,8,1>UD { align1 1Q };
79
mov(16) m1<1>UD g3<8,8,1>UD { align1 1H };
80
mov(16) g8<1>UD g0<8,8,1>UD { align1 WE_all 1H };
81
mov(8) m1<1>F g4<8,8,1>UD { align1 1Q };
82
mov(16) m1<1>F g4<8,8,1>UD { align1 1H };
83
mov(8) m4<1>.xF g1<0>.xD { align16 NoDDClr 1Q };
84
mov(8) m4<1>.yF g40<4>.xD { align16 NoDDClr,NoDDChk 1Q };
85
mov(8) g15<1>.xF g87<4>.xD { align16 NoDDClr 1Q };
86
mov(8) g15<1>.yF g88<4>.xD { align16 NoDDClr,NoDDChk 1Q };
87
mov(8) m4<1>.wF g42<4>.xD { align16 NoDDChk 1Q };
88
mov(8) g15<1>.wF g90<4>.xD { align16 NoDDChk 1Q };
89
mov(8) g7<1>F g4<8,8,1>UD { align1 1Q };
90
mov(16) g7<1>F g5<8,8,1>UD { align1 1H };
91
mov(8) g3<1>D g11<4>D { align16 1Q };
92
mov(8) g20<1>F g14<4>.xF { align16 1Q };
93
mov(8) g5<1>.yF g21<4>.yF { align16 NoDDClr 1Q };
94
mov(8) g5<1>.zF g23<4>.zF { align16 NoDDClr,NoDDChk 1Q };
95
mov(8) g6<1>.xzwD g5<4>.wwywD { align16 NoDDChk 1Q };
96
mov(8) m3<1>.zwF 0x30000000VF /* [0F, 0F, 0F, 1F]VF */ { align16 NoDDClr 1Q };
97
mov.nz.f0.0(8) g4<1>F -(abs)g2<0,1,0>F { align1 1Q };
98
(+f0.0) mov(8) g4<1>F 0xbf800000F /* -1F */ { align1 1Q };
99
mov.nz.f0.0(16) g4<1>F -(abs)g2<0,1,0>F { align1 1H };
100
(+f0.0) mov(16) g4<1>F 0xbf800000F /* -1F */ { align1 1H };
101
mov(8) g21<1>.xzwD 0D { align16 NoDDClr 1Q };
102
mov(8) g3<1>.yzwF 0x30000000VF /* [0F, 0F, 0F, 1F]VF */ { align16 NoDDChk 1Q };
103
mov(8) g3<1>.xD g6<4>.xD { align16 NoDDClr,NoDDChk 1Q };
104
mov(8) g3<1>.xF -g18<4>.xF { align16 NoDDChk 1Q };
105
mov.sat(8) g12<1>.xF g1<0>.zF { align16 1Q };
106
(+f0.0.any4h) mov(8) g4<1>.xD -1D { align16 1Q };
107
mov(8) m2<1>.zD g2<4>.zD { align16 NoDDClr,NoDDChk 1Q };
108
mov(8) g3<1>.xyzF g1.4<0>.xyzzUD { align16 NoDDClr 1Q };
109
mov(8) g3<1>.wF g1<0>.xUD { align16 NoDDChk 1Q };
110
mov(8) g3<1>D -g2<0,1,0>D { align1 1Q };
111
mov(16) g3<1>D -g2<0,1,0>D { align1 1H };
112
mov.nz.f0.0(8) null<1>.xD g1<0>.xD { align16 1Q };
113
mov(8) g2<1>UD g2<8,8,1>F { align1 1Q };
114
mov(16) g2<1>UD g2<8,8,1>F { align1 1H };
115
mov.sat(8) g10<1>F g2.2<0,1,0>F { align1 1Q };
116
mov.sat(16) g15<1>F g2.2<0,1,0>F { align1 1H };
117
mov(8) m3<1>.zwF 0D { align16 NoDDChk 1Q };
118
mov.nz.f0.0(8) null<1>D g2<8,8,1>D { align1 1Q };
119
mov.nz.f0.0(16) null<1>D g87<8,8,1>D { align1 1H };
120
mov(8) m2<1>D 0D { align1 1Q };
121
mov(16) m2<1>D 0D { align1 1H };
122
mov.sat(8) m4<1>.wF g20<4>.wF { align16 NoDDChk 1Q };
123
mov(8) g55<1>.zD 1045220557D { align16 NoDDClr,NoDDChk 1Q };
124
(+f0.0.all4h) mov(8) g60<1>.xD -1D { align16 1Q };
125
mov(8) m7<1>F 0x0F /* 0F */ { align1 2Q };
126
mov.sat(8) m4<1>F 0x3f800000F /* 1F */ { align16 1Q };
127
mov(8) g33<1>.xF 0x3e8F /* 1.4013e-42F */ { align16 1Q };
128
mov(1) f0<1>UW g1.14<0,1,0>UW { align1 WE_all 1N };
129
(-f0.0) mov(8) g4<1>F g2<8,8,1>F { align1 1Q };
130
(-f0.0) mov(8) g8<1>F g4<8,8,1>F { align1 2Q };
131
mov(8) m4<1>.xF g8<4>.xF { align16 NoDDClr 1Q };
132
mov(8) m4<1>.yF g8<4>.xF { align16 NoDDChk 1Q };
133
mov(1) g1<1>UD g0.1<0,1,0>UD { align1 WE_all 1N };
134
mov(1) g7.14<1>UW f0.1<0,1,0>UW { align1 WE_all 1N };
135
mov(8) g12<1>UW 0x32103210V { align1 WE_all 1Q };
136
mov.sat(8) m4<1>F -g6<4>D { align16 1Q };
137
mov(8) m5<1>.yF g4<4>.yF { align16 NoDDClr,NoDDChk 1Q };
138
mov(8) g12<1>.xD acc0<4>D { align16 1Q };
139
mov(8) m8<1>.xyzD 0x737271VF /* [17F, 18F, 19F, 0F]VF */ { align16 1Q };
140
mov(8) m7<1>.zwD 0x706e0000VF /* [0F, 0F, 15F, 16F]VF */ { align16 NoDDChk 1Q };
141
mov.sat(8) m4<1>.xyzF -g13<4>.xyzzD { align16 NoDDClr 1Q };
142
mov(8) m2<1>UD 0x0F /* 0F */ { align1 1Q };
143
mov(16) m2<1>UD 0x0F /* 0F */ { align1 1H };
144
mov(8) m1<1>UD g4<8,8,1>UD { align1 WE_all 2Q };
145
mov(8) m4<1>.yF 0x40a00000F /* 5F */ { align16 NoDDChk 1Q };
146
mov(8) g6<1>UD 0D { align1 1Q };
147
mov(16) g8<1>UD 0D { align1 1H };
148
mov(8) m4<1>.yzF 0x484000VF /* [0F, 2F, 3F, 0F]VF */ { align16 NoDDClr,NoDDChk 1Q };
149
mov(8) m4<1>F g10<4>UD { align16 1Q };
150
mov(8) g20<1>.yzD 0x404800VF /* [0F, 3F, 2F, 0F]VF */ { align16 NoDDChk 1Q };
151
mov.sat(8) m4<1>.yzF g1<0>.xxzzF { align16 NoDDClr,NoDDChk 1Q };
152
mov.sat(8) m4<1>.xF -g1<0>.wF { align16 NoDDClr 1Q };
153
mov.sat(8) m4<1>.yF -g11<4>.xD { align16 NoDDClr,NoDDChk 1Q };
154
mov.sat(8) m4<1>.wF -g13<4>.xD { align16 NoDDChk 1Q };
155
mov(8) m1<1>UD g9<8,8,1>F { align1 1Q };
156
mov(16) m1<1>UD g11<8,8,1>F { align1 1H };
157
mov(8) g84<1>UD g80.1<16,8,2>UW { align1 1Q };
158
mov(16) g45<1>UD g37.1<16,8,2>UW { align1 1H };
159
mov(8) g48<1>UD g44.3<32,8,4>UB { align1 1Q };
160
mov(16) g99<1>UD g91.3<32,8,4>UB { align1 1H };
161
mov.z.f0.0(8) null<1>D g22<8,8,1>F { align1 1Q };
162
mov.z.f0.0(16) null<1>D g28<8,8,1>F { align1 1H };
163
mov.nz.f0.0(8) g11<1>F -(abs)g1<0>F { align16 1Q };
164
(+f0.0) mov(8) g11<1>F 0xbf800000F /* -1F */ { align16 1Q };
165
166